The New Year has come and the resolutions have been made. The number one resolution is usually to get into better shape or improve your health. Keeping one or both of those resolutions would be great but we probably all agree that it's pretty hard to do. So, what if it were easier to keep those resolutions? Well, it's easier to get into shape or improve your overall health when you add massage therapy to your health and fitness regimen.

How can massage therapy help you to keep your resolutions? There are many ways but two stand out. First, massage therapy by itself can help you improve your health due to the many healthy benefits of massage including: improved circulation, greater flexibility, better sleep, feelings of wellness, and reduced muscular pain. Secondly, massage therapy can help you get into shape because the nagging soreness and pain from a new workout routine can be reduced or eliminated. When your pain levels are reduced you are more likely to want to continue your workouts. Receiving regular massage therapy can also prevent muscle soreness and minor injuries that could prevent you from keeping up with your workout schedule.

Now that you know that massage therapy can help you improve your health and fitness, you might want to know what types of massage therapy are available to you. There are many styles and techniques used in massage therapy but there are some that are available pretty much anywhere that you can integrate into your health and fitness routine. The best known massage therapy techniques are:

1. Swedish Massage - this is the most common of massage techniques in the United States and perhaps the world. Swedish massage is known for its long gliding strokes, kneading strokes, friction strokes, and percussion as well as joint movements that feel great while improving range of motion. It's most often thought of as a "spa" type of massage but it's much more than that. Swedish massage is great for improving circulation, improving range of motion of your joints, and helping you actually feel better in your own skin. Swedish massage can range from light pressure to a heavier pressure depending on your comfort.

2. Deep Tissue Massage - right behind Swedish massage, Deep Tissue Massage is one of the best known and most often requested massage techniques. This massage is used to root out chronic tension in the deeper musculature and connective tissues that contributes to pain and loss of range of motion in joints. While some practitioners use a heavier, sometimes uncomfortable, pressure in Deep Tissue Massage it should be noted that a more moderate pressure can reach deep tissues and achieve great results with little discomfort.

3. Sports Massage - just like it sounds, Sports Massage is geared toward athletes at every level from professional to the "weekend warrior" and those who strive for a higher level of fitness. Rather than a specific form of massage, Sports Massage is generally a combination of massage techniques tailored to the athlete's needs. The Sports Massage might be applied to one area to relieve pain or might be more general in nature to assure overall performance.

4. Neuromuscular Therapy - also called "NMT", Neuromuscular Therapy is a well known technique for relieving muscular pain throughout the body even "referred" pain that originates from someplace other than where it's felt. This technique uses very targeted massage techniques, positioning, and stretching to release myofascial trigger points in muscles as well as restrictions in tendons, muscular attachments, and sometimes fascia surrounding the muscle.

All of the massage techniques described here can help you keep on track with your pursuit of better health. Of course there are many more massage therapy techniques available that are relaxing, stress reducing, and that relieve chronic tension and pain. You actually don't have to know what type of massage to ask for, you just need to know what you want to achieve. Do you just want to relax? Reduce muscle soreness? Relieve pain? Improve posture? Ask your massage therapist what they recommend for your particular health and fitness needs and they'll help you keep your resolutions.

When you decide to have your tattoo, you know where to go to: to the best tattoo artist who works in the most reputable tattoo shop. But what are the factors that you need to look for in a tattoo parlor? Here are some tips to spot for what's hot and what's hot:

1. Make sure the artist is wearing some gloves. He can be the best tattoo artist in the world, but if he doesn't wear a glove, it only means he doesn't care about hygiene. Remember, your skin gets punctured, which means you're susceptible to get bacteria along the way. It will further complicate if your tattoo artist has dirty hands.

2. Check the needles. Have you heard of AIDS? Even if you're in a so-called reputable tattoo shop or parlor, you can still get this much-dreaded disease. How? Through the needles that they're using. There is a huge possibility that the liquid containing the virus will be injected into your skin. That's why you have to ensure that before the start of the tattoo process, the needles that are going to be used are brand-new, not used and not even just cleaned. Most of all, see to it that that tattoo artist will throw the needles after to make sure that he doesn't get to use it to somebody else.

3. A reputable tattoo shop should be cleaned. There are too many people who believe that an artistic person doesn't really mind cleaning his surroundings. After all, that's how he gets to express his creative side. However, it shouldn't be used as an excuse especially when you're talking about tattooing. So before you decide to even have yourself tattooed with the best tattoo artist, everything should be spic and span. The countertops should be free of dust. Jewelry, bracelets, and rings should be put away particularly in the working area. Moreover, there must be a designated bin for the needles, ink cups, and other types of trash. There should be a sink where you can wash your tattoo after as well as a changing or dressing room.

4. Look for recommendations. With due diligence, you can definitely find the right tattoo parlor for you. You can look for their shops in the yellow pages, in your local daily, or even in the World Wide Web. However, doing this can be taxing. To save you time, you can simply ask for some recommendations from your friends and even family members. Surely, they wouldn't get you someone who can not do the work.

5. Check your state laws. Laws vary from state to state. Before you get your tattoo from the best tattoo artist, it's advisable to double-check the rules that govern tattoo parlor and shops. Perhaps they're asking them to get their own licenses before they can operate their business. You can make use of this as your own guideline in determining whether it's a reputable tattoo shop or not.

It pays to make a thorough research first when it comes to searching for the best tattoo artist or the most reputable tattoo parlor.

Rolfing and Rolf Movement have become similar terms used to describe technique that can foster a shift in structural and functional potentials. Rolf Movement will be the focus of this outline describing what a Rolf Movement four series incorporates into sessions to cultivate this shift.

Four independent sessions will explore breath, appendicular, axial, and cranial orientation and awareness. Simply by bringing awareness to an area, being with it and observing its intention, an individual can transform their container and initiation of expression.

After meeting with the client and discussing their history and information on the client intake evaluation, the first movement session can begin. Few are truly associated with their own breath, its rhythm, and when they hold it. It appears that the body organizes around the breath and its rhythm, be it hypo or hyperventilating. A walking exploration of breath and movement in gravity, fast and slow, is the best way to start the relationship.

When the client communicates a new awareness, have client move out of vertical gravity to supine position on the table to explore. The exploration should be from the top of the head to the bottom of the feet. A diaphragm release and integration can be utilized while the client breathes in and out of each bodily segment. The whole session should be at least an hour for standing and table exploration.

This second movement session should focus on support and how the feet and legs relate to the pelvis. The client should be able to begin with an increased awareness of breath and body from the first meeting. With the client vertical in gravity begin a walking assessment navigating sensation and awareness from the earth to the foot, from the foot up to the knee, and from the knee to the pelvis. Rolf yoga is great way to do some seated work with each foot, foot up toes down and toes up foot down.

Lye the client supine and explore heel drags with each foot. Knee overs help the client feel the relationship and weight of femur in hip, and sets up for Kaya Kalpa exercise to bring the support session together. These movements and exercises are technique for cultivating support for the pelvis.

As we move to the third movement session, we in turn move up the body looking at the relationship between the pelvic and shoulder girdles. Contra-lateral movement is the manifesting integration of the spinal engine. When there is little or no contra-lateral movement the mid-dorsal hinge needs a wake up call. With the client supine on the table, knees bent, and feet flat have client (push) right foot into table and (reach) across their body with the contra-lateral arm parallel with the right shoulder. The movement should be subtle, from the inside out.

Have client come into gravity and repeat in a seated position. A closed chain technique called Rolling wave is a great way to complete the integration. This technique moves from the foot to the hand and provides a serratus/transversus activation integration, which brings the work to the shoulder, neck and head.

Beginning with arm drops, feeling the weight and letting it fall without inhibition can address the head, neck and the shoulder girdle. The tendency is to hold on, and this is precisely what we are witnessing. Ocular decoupling limbs of expression affords the opportunity to release inhibitions in the range of motion restricted by perception, similar to ocular decoupling limbs of support which we did not do this series.

The final technique is called ocular-vestibular-cervical reflex. Its a large group of terms that communicates that the exproprioception feedback we use for hand-eye coordination will be able to release and reset. These four sessions combined will hopefully enable the client to experience a new reality. Humans spend a lot of time looking, touching, and forming beliefs. Rolfing and The Rolf Movement techniques help our species to be more integrally informed.

Biotech companies in San Diego are actively recruiting, and if you have an interest in biology, genetic engineering, molecular biology, or in one of the many related fields, then a career in the San Diego biotech industry may be for you. Biotechnology is defined as the integration of engineering and technology to the life sciences, and is also referred to as bioengineering in some circles. In biotechnology, microorganisms, and or biological substances are used in specific ways, which include, but are not limited to, drug and hormone production, food production, and waste product conversion.

As mentioned, biotechnology is a broadly encompassing term, including the fields of molecular biology, cell biology, and genetic engineering.

Molecular biology is the study of the structure and activity of the macromolecules necessary for life, which consist of DNA, amino acids, proteins, and other types of molecules.

Genetic engineering is the study of the process of creating what is known as recombinant DNA, a process that is accomplished by dividing strands of DNA and then splicing them together in different ways.

Cell biology is the study of cellular components and the ways in which cells interact.

If you are looking for, or anticipating a search for, a San Diego biotech job, you should know that in this type of field, higher education degrees are an absolute must. A bachelors degree in a related field is considered to be the base education for a biotech professional, and it is highly recommended that those seeking to enter the biotech field obtain an advanced degree in molecular biology, biochemistry, genetics, cell physiology, or a related field.

Biotechnologists can expect to spend the majority of their time in a laboratory setting, but most biotech professionals also collaborate with other researchers on projects and scientific papers detailing their experiment results and research findings. If you are currently an undergraduate looking towards a future San Diego biotech job, you should plan on coauthoring a scientific research paper with a more senior collaborator before you graduate.

Biotech professionals generally work for large biotech firms or companies, but many also find career fulfillment in academia, and in the areas of genomic, proteomic, and bioinformatics research fields. The question of whether to work for an established large biotech firm, an energetic start up company, or in the academic fields is best answered through research and by examining your own career goals and expectations.

According to a 2002 report from the Brookings Institution stated that the U.S. biotech industry is concentrated largely within Boston, Los Angeles, New York, San Diego, Raleigh Durham, San Francisco, Seattle, and Washington D.C. and Baltimore. Lower back pain, as well as middle back pain and upper back pain, can be caused by several factors, which can be either chronic or acute. Acute back pain is usually related to a recent occurrence, and chronic back pain is one that has been present for an extended amount of time.

To determine what type of back pain you have, the first thing to ask yourself is how long the pain has been occurring. This will answer the question as to whether you suffer from acute or chronic back pain, which will then aid you in developing a back pain treatment.

Lower back pain factors

Two common causes for lower back pain are muscle imbalance and trauma, such as an injury. An imbalance in muscles means that muscles which are used frequently become weak, while unused muscles stay strong. This causes sharp back pain and discomfort until a balance is established once again. Trauma in muscles comes from overuse and overextension, resulting in pain and injury. Pain and poor movement can be a result of unused or overused muscles.
Poor posture has been known as a direct link to chronic back pain. This is caused from misalignments of the spine and pelvis. It causes increased stress on the muscles, joints, and the ligaments. Stretched out, weak, and stressed muscles cannot give adequate support to the spine in order to achieve good posture. Centuries ago, herbal skin care was pretty much the only way to take care of skin. These days, herbal skin care routines have been replaced by synthetic and chemical-based skin care routines. Skin care products range from basic moisturizers and cleansers to specialized products that promise to reduce wrinkles, diminish fine lines, and revitalize your skin to give you a more youthful appearance. The question is how safe are all these chemicals we put into and onto our bodies every day and what can we do?

Although the thought of making your own herbal skin care products at home is nice, many people just don't have the time or knowledge it takes to make their own skin care products. Because of this, the commercial market for herbal skin care products is on the rise. You have to ask yourself, however, are these products really completely natural? In many cases, the answer is no, since many products contain some sort of chemicals anyway.

When you use products like lotions, creams, and cosmetics on your skin, the ingredients are absorbed into your body. This is why doctors use patches for things like Nicotine withdrawal, pain medication, and even birth control. By using herbal natural skin care products, you can reduce the amount of chemicals you put into your body.

Natural ingredients are known for their cleansing properties, antiseptic characteristics, and moisturizing abilities. Things like aloe, chamomile, and rosemary, are known to be good cleansers. Lavender, thyme, and fennel are great antiseptics and toners. Tea tree oil, beeswax, and cocoa butter are widely-known as moisturizers.

Aloe-containing creams, gels, and ointments are good for minor burns, sunburn, cuts, abrasions, wounds, and frostbite. Aloe is also found in many shampoos, soaps, sunscreens, skin creams and other cosmetics that are used to soothe, heal, protect, and moisturize the skin. Aloe Vera lotions are widely used for cleansing the skin. Many of the skin care products containing aloe vera are also fortified with Vitamin E and collagen to help maintain skin elasticity and lock in moisture.

Chamomile is an ideal ingredient for treating acne, irritation, rashes, eczema, psoriasis, hypersensitive skin and allergic conditions. Chamomile oil has also great wound healing properties. Using chamomile helps to reduce puffiness, cleanse pores of impurities, and helps reduce redness of the skin.

Rosemary oil helps cleanse and rejuvenate oily and dull skin. Popular in anti-aging creams, it has excellent toning effects on loose, sagging skin, and helps increase blood flow which in turn promotes healthy skin function. It helps to relieve puffiness and swelling, and promotes a glowing, youthful looking complexion.

Lavender helps the skin heal itself, stimulates cell growth, reduces inflammation, prevents scarring and helps balance oil production. It exhibits antibacterial, antiviral, antiseptic, bactericide and anti-inflammatory properties which makes it ideal for use in products that treat skin problems like acne, eczema, minor infections, oily skin, boils, burns, sunburn, wounds and psoriasis. Lavander also makes a great toner.

Thyme is considered to be a great antioxidant,astringent and a beneifical ingredient for improving skin tone. It's also a powerful antifungal and antiviral used to help keep skin free from fungi and viruses.

Fennel oil is used for soothing, cleansing and toning the skin, while at the same time improving circulation and fighting water retention and puffiness.

Rose extract and rose oil are great for promoting a youthful complexion with good tone, elasticity and an even color.

Tea tree oil can be used to fight and clear up acne, skin lesions and blemishes, cold sores, athlete's foot, sunburn, fungal nail infections and infected wounds, and at the same time it soothes the irritated and inflamed skin.

witch hazel helps with controlling water loss, is a good astringent, an antioxidant, and helps reduce skin redness.

Avocado oil is easily absorbed by the skin and is used as an emollient. Its hydrating properties make it ideal for dry, dehydrated or aged skin. Avocado oil is also used to relieve the dryness and itching of psoriasis and eczema.

Beeswax is a thickening agent, emulsifier, and humectant. It has wonderfully emollient, soothing and softening properties and helps the skin retain moisture.

Cocoa butter is a rich emollient which is great for nourishing very dry and dehydrated skin.

Green tea is an antioxidant that helps prevents free radical damage, skin tumors and cancers. Green tea has been tauted as an effective anti-aging ingredient, anti-inflammatory agent, and helps fight collagen breakdown, which helps you maintain firm and elastic skin.

Herbal skin care products have many uses, as you can see. Whether it's skin basic skin care or treatment of skin problems like, acne, eczema and psorasis there is an ingredient in nature that will help. Most herbal skin care products have no side effects, which makes them a better choice than synthetic products. I receive approximately 5,000 emails containing spam each and every day. Well, maybe not that many, but it sure seems like it. Spam is spiraling out of control and shows no signs of stopping. The question is, where does spam come from, and can you do anything about it?

Most of the spam I receive in my inbox is sexually explicit, but I still like to look at it because some of this junk is actually quite entertaining. My personal favorites are offers to purchase discounted Canadian Viagra, ads for pornographic websites, and bogus work-from-home programs.

How do these people get their grimy hands on your email address? One way they can get it is through opt-in email. When you order something online, as part of the subscription or service that you signed up for, you may have inadvertently agreed to receive offers via email from that company in the future.

As a result, said company adds you to their mailing list and begins to send you email. This is perfectly legal as long as the company provides you with a way to unsubscribe from their mailing list. If they do not provide you with a means to unsubscribe, then the emails they are sending you are considered spam.

To make matters worse, a spammer will sell your email address and any other information you submitted to them to hundreds or even thousands of other companies who are looking for leads. Before you know it, your email address has been circulated everywhere. Once this happens, there is almost no way to prevent spam from reaching your inbox.

Another common way your email address can end up on a mailing list is when an internet marketer purchases a list of email addresses from someone else, and then sends a joke or an interesting cartoon to everyone on that list and asks you to forward it along to all your friends and relatives.

Once you forward the message, the email has a program attached to it that will copy the list of addresses that the message has been forwarded to and send that list back to the person who originally sent you the email. So now, that person not only has your email address, but also has the email address of everyone you forwarded the message to.

Another popular technique is known as harvesting. This is accomplished by writing a simple retrieval program that searches through every web site listed on a search engine for a certain keyword, and then grabs any any email addresses that are posted on those sites, and subsequently sends them back to the harvester. Using this technology, it is possible to acquire thousands of email addresses in an hour or less.

Harvesting has become a legal dilemma. The email marketing community feels that they should be allowed to harvest email addresses that are posted on public websites. In their opinion, if someone has posted their email address for all to see, then other people have the right to contact that person and ask them questions or send them offers.

However, web sites where email addresses are posted have threatened legal action against anyone that harvests email addresses from their site and uses them to build spam lists. Unfortunately, these web sites really have no way to prevent this, and it will only get worse in the future.

We will never stop spam completely. Both big businesses and small businesses have a strong incentive to send bulk email, because it costs nothing, and is a valuable tool for increasing their customer base. Sending regular mail or hiring a telemarketer costs a lot of money and is extremely ineffective. As a result, most companies would prefer to send massive amounts of email. So, expect your inbox to be chock full of spam for many years to come.
